2005 Philadelphia Soul Season

The 2005 Philadelphia Soul season was the second season of the Philadelphia Soul. The Soul finished 6-10 on the season and missed the playoffs. The Soul got off to a great start, with a 66-35 win over the Austin Wranglers. But after Week 5, the Soul had 2 wins and 3 losses, leading to the firing of head coach Michael Trigg, and the signing of replacement head coach James Fuller.
